No Pain But Still Gain While You Lose Weight


Fallen victim to the belief that exercise has to hard to be beneficial? Well, prepare for good news. Moderate exercise benefits the heart: You don’t have to feel the burn. 


Just 30 minutes a day of walking brings as much risk reduction for heart attack as a high-intensity exercise program, according to a study published in the Archives of Internal Medicine, 1999.


Surprisingly, aerobic fitness can also be increased by frequent moderate exercise such as walking according to a study published in the November 2005 issue of Archives of Internal Medicine.
